Technical Evaluation Criteria

Deep-dive into the technical capabilities you should validate before committing

Security Architecture

Key Requirements

  • Zero Trust network design
  • Defense-in-depth layers
  • Secrets management (Vault, SOPS)
  • Identity & access management
  • Encryption at rest and in transit
  • SIEM with threat intelligence

How to Evaluate

  • Request architecture diagrams
  • Review incident response playbooks
  • Validate compliance certifications
  • Test security automation

Infrastructure as Code

Key Requirements

  • Version-controlled infrastructure
  • Immutable infrastructure patterns
  • Automated drift detection
  • Multi-environment management
  • Disaster recovery automation
  • Cost optimization automation

How to Evaluate

  • Review IaC repositories
  • Check PR review process
  • Validate testing practices
  • Assess rollback procedures

GitOps Practices

Key Requirements

  • Git as single source of truth
  • Automated deployments
  • Progressive delivery (canary, blue-green)
  • Automated rollbacks
  • Audit trail for all changes
  • Policy enforcement (OPA, Kyverno)

How to Evaluate

  • Review deployment workflows
  • Check policy enforcement
  • Validate RBAC implementation
  • Test rollback scenarios

Observability Stack

Key Requirements

  • Metrics, logs, and traces unified
  • SLO/SLI implementation
  • Distributed tracing
  • Real-user monitoring
  • Custom dashboards per service
  • Intelligent alerting (no noise)

How to Evaluate

  • Request sample dashboards
  • Review alerting philosophy
  • Check on-call processes
  • Validate cost management

Container & Orchestration

Key Requirements

  • Kubernetes expertise
  • Service mesh implementation
  • Container security scanning
  • Resource optimization
  • Multi-cluster management
  • Helm/Kustomize patterns

How to Evaluate

  • Review cluster architectures
  • Check security policies
  • Validate upgrade processes
  • Assess HA/DR capabilities

CI/CD Integration

Key Requirements

  • Pipeline security scanning
  • Automated compliance checks
  • Artifact signing & verification
  • Environment promotion gates
  • Test automation integration
  • Deployment approval workflows

How to Evaluate

  • Review pipeline templates
  • Check security scanning
  • Validate test coverage
  • Assess deployment velocity

Red Flags When Evaluating Providers

Warning signs that should make you think twice before signing a contract

Lack of Technical Depth

Sales team can't answer architecture questions. No certified engineers on staff.

What to look for instead: Ask to speak with actual engineers who will work on your account. Request certifications.

Proprietary Lock-In

Everything built on proprietary tools. No standard IaC or GitOps practices.

What to look for instead: Insist on infrastructure-as-code in your Git repos. Avoid vendor-specific tooling.

Black Box Operations

No visibility into what they're doing. Documentation kept in their systems only.

What to look for instead: Demand documentation in your wiki, code in your repos, transparency in all work.

Offshore-Only Teams

No US-based engineers. Communication happens only via tickets.

What to look for instead: Ask about team locations, time zones, communication methods. Test responsiveness.

No Compliance Experience

They've never done SOC 2, ISO 27001, or your required framework before.

What to look for instead: Request case studies, certifications, and compliance team credentials.

Manual Processes

Still logging into servers, making manual changes, no automation.

What to look for instead: Ask about IaC coverage, automation level, and change management processes.

Slow Response Times

SLAs measured in hours or days, not minutes. No 24/7 coverage.

What to look for instead: Review actual SLA commitments. Ask about on-call processes and escalation paths.

Inflexible Pricing

Rigid packages that don't match your needs. Hidden fees for everything.

What to look for instead: Request transparent pricing. Understand what's included vs. additional cost.

Technical Evaluation Checklist

Use this checklist when vetting potential managed service providers

Technical Validation

  • Review their IaC repositories and coding standards
  • Speak with their senior engineers (not just sales)
  • Request architecture diagrams from similar clients
  • Test their incident response process
  • Validate security certifications and compliance
  • Check their technology radar and innovation track record

Collaboration Assessment

  • Understand communication channels and frequency
  • Review knowledge transfer and documentation practices
  • Assess cultural fit with your engineering team
  • Test responsiveness during sales process (indicator of future)
  • Clarify decision-making authority and escalation
  • Verify team stability and turnover rates

Business Terms

  • Clear SLA definitions with penalties for misses
  • Flexible contract terms (avoid 3-year lock-ins)
  • Transparent pricing with no hidden fees
  • IP ownership of all work product
  • Reasonable termination clauses with transition support
  • Insurance coverage (E&O, cyber liability)
